Jackson County residents: be BearWise this fall

October 19, 2023

CENTRAL POINT, Ore – Fall means it’s “fattening up” season for black bears before denning for the winter. While natural food sources are plentiful this year in Jackson County, bears don’t turn down free food.

ODFW is getting reports of black bears raiding garbage cans and backyard chicken feed bins in Jackson County. Biologists encourage residents, particularly those living in the wildland-urban interface, to be Bear-Wise:

  • Secure chicken feed and other livestock feed.
  • Put garbage cans out just before pick-up.
  • Keep pet food indoors.
  • Remove bird feeders.
  • Clean up fruit under fruit trees.
  • Keep BBQ grills clean or in garage.
  • Never intentionally feed bears.

Once bears find a taste for garbage, pet food and other human food sources, they can quickly become habituated and a safety risk to people. The best way to keep bears and people safe is to prevent bears from getting these food rewards.

If you encounter a bear:

  • STOP: Never approach a bear at any time for any reason. If you see bear cubs, leave the area.
  • GIVE IT SPACE: Give any bear you encounter a way to escape.
  • STAY CALM: Do not run or make sudden movements. Face the bear and slowly back away.
  • AVOID EYE CONTACT: Don’t make eye contact with the bear.
  • DON’T RUN: It may encourage the bear to chase you.
  • FIGHT BACK: In the unlikely event you are attacked, fight back, shout, be aggressive, use rocks, sticks and hands.
